How to overcome the fear of sex – 9 steps

Image: soundcloud.co.

He fear of sex It is something very common in the early stages of sexual discovery. We fear the pain that intercourse can cause, we fear that the encounter will not go well, or we develop very high expectations that we later do not want to break. In other cases the fear of sex derives from negative experiences, these being much more difficult to face. Do you feel afraid of intercourse? Steps to follow:
1

The first step is to try to discover the origin of fear of sex. Many times it starts from inexperience, from not knowing what we will encounter, but in cases in which the fear of intercourse is derived from negative or traumatic experiences that are possibly generating other sexual dysfunctions, it is very important to go to a specialist. if you realize that on your part it is difficult to overcome it. The help of a professional will allow you to have sex again and enjoy it to the fullest.

Once you know your pleasure points, go ahead and explore them with your partner. Sex is not only penetration: oral sex, masturbation with a partner, stimulation of erogenous zones such as the breasts or testicles are also part of sex. As you explore these points with your partner, without needing to penetrate, you will feel much more comfortable with the idea of ​​sex, little by little overcoming fear.

4

Take the matter calmly. Many times the fear of sex can come from the pressure generated by our partner or by the environment. Don’t let this affect youyour partner must understand that each person has their time, but at the same time you must work little by little to feel more secure sexually to overcome your fear.

Petting is a good practice to carry out to increase intimacy and help you enjoy closeness and sexual contact with your partner.

5

Don’t move on to penetration unless you are excited and lubricating. This aspect is very important because a lack of arousal usually generates pain and discomfort during penetration that can make sex an uncomfortable and unpleasant experience.

6

have sex only when you are safe and comfortable. Before doing so, it is very important to take into account the previous suggestions: know your body and your pleasure points well, feel comfortable with your partner, have tried other forms of sex together and be truly excited and ready to do it.

Many times fear arises from ignorance, which is why it is very important to investigate all those aspects that generate sexual doubts in you. Visit your gynecologist or a specialist, or read information about the topics that make you doubt on specialized websites. Don’t ask people who may have as little information as you or this will only confuse you more.

Also talk to your partner about your situation, it is important that the other person knows what is happening so that they can understand you and support you with whatever you need.
